An appalled couple were left furious and concerned for their newborn after claiming they found bugs in their baby formula.

Kirsty Humphrey said she was horrified after she went to make four-month old Oakley his food, only to find insects in the powder.

Now the 27-year-old, along with husband Chris, is worried for little Oakley who has had SMA Baby Formula before.

Speaking to getwestlondon , Kirsty said: "I was so angry, I didn't know what to do, it's not something you expect to see.

"It's for a baby, you'd think there'd be more safety there.

"We had Oakley after IVF treatment and we don't want anything to happen."

After calling SMA Baby Care, she said the company have asked them to send off a sample of the formula after they discovered the bug on Wednesday (January 25) night.

The Ruislip resident added: "They came back to me and weren't really apologetic and said we need to send it off for investigation and they'll give me vouchers for a new one.

"But if my baby got ill, a voucher wouldn't make him better.

"We were even more worried because she paused on the phone when I said he was an IVF baby."

The batch, from Eastcote High Street's Superdrug, was well within its sell by date, which surprised dad Chris even more.

"I was shocked, we had another batch but didn't use it just in case," he said.

Both agreed that they felt it should be highlighted in case a new born baby gets ill and "it's too late".

A spokesman for SMA Baby said: "We profusely apologise if consumers find any products not in a good condition.

"We cannot comment any further until the investigation is complete."
